Transaction 6b5dcbec95086857ca50abfc2014a5e45f7ff6921091cb8585643f9d437e9689
1 Input
1 Output
-
6b5dcbec95086857ca50abfc2014a5e45f7ff6921091cb8585643f9d437e9689:0
- value
- 404139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b05477d04f63f06fd22527fe530e3a08eb1f1879 OP_EQUAL
- address
- 3HmN3FH7q2PPnLVrmFi4jLLyVXisCMS9rU